怎么知道当前excel用什么编码
作者:excel百科网
|
366人看过
发布时间:2026-01-22 22:57:14
标签:
如何知道当前Excel使用什么编码?深度解析与实用技巧在使用Excel处理数据时,了解当前使用的编码方式至关重要。Excel的编码方式直接影响数据的存储、读取以及计算结果的准确性。本文将从Excel编码的基本概念出发,逐步分析其工作原
如何知道当前Excel使用什么编码?深度解析与实用技巧
在使用Excel处理数据时,了解当前使用的编码方式至关重要。Excel的编码方式直接影响数据的存储、读取以及计算结果的准确性。本文将从Excel编码的基本概念出发,逐步分析其工作原理,并提供实用的判断与操作方法,帮助用户全面掌握如何判断当前Excel使用的是哪种编码。
一、Excel编码的基本概念
Excel文件本质上是基于二进制格式存储的,但为了便于人类阅读和操作,Excel使用了一种称为字符编码的机制,将字符转换为数字,以实现数据的存储与处理。Excel支持多种编码方式,其中最常见的包括UTF-8、UTF-16、ASCII、ISO-8859-1等。
1.1 编码的作用
编码的作用在于将字符转换为统一的数字形式,使得不同系统之间能够一致地理解和处理数据。例如,ASCII编码是最早的编码方式,只支持英文字符,而UTF-8则支持多种语言的字符,包括中文、日文、韩文等。
1.2 Excel支持的编码方式
Excel支持以下几种主要编码方式:
- UTF-8:国际通用的编码方式,支持多种语言字符,是现代办公中最常用的方式。
- UTF-16:比UTF-8更复杂,适用于Unicode字符的存储,是Windows系统中默认的编码方式。
- ASCII:仅支持英文字符,是最早的编码方式。
- ISO-8859-1:是欧洲地区常用的编码方式,支持拉丁字母。
- KOI8-R:俄罗斯地区常用的编码方式。
- GB2312:中国地区常用的编码方式。
- Big5:台湾地区常用的编码方式。
二、如何判断当前Excel使用的是哪种编码
判断当前Excel使用的是哪种编码,可以通过以下几种方式实现。
2.1 通过文件属性查看
Excel文件在Windows系统中,可以通过右键点击文件,选择“属性”来查看文件的编码方式。
1. 右键点击Excel文件。
2. 选择“属性”。
3. 点击“详细信息”标签。
4. 在“文件属性”中,查看“编码”字段,即可知道当前文件所使用的编码方式。
2.2 通过Excel的设置查看
在Excel中,可以通过设置查看当前使用的编码方式。
1. 打开Excel,点击左上角的“文件”菜单。
2. 选择“选项”。
3. 在“Excel选项”窗口中,点击“高级”。
4. 在“字体”选项卡中,查看“编码”字段,即可知道当前使用的编码方式。
2.3 通过VBA脚本查看
对于高级用户,可以通过VBA脚本来查看Excel当前使用的编码方式。
vba
Sub ShowEncoding()
Dim encoding As String
encoding = ActiveWorkbook.Encoding
MsgBox "当前Excel编码为: " & encoding
End Sub
运行这段代码后,Excel会弹出一个消息框,显示当前使用的编码方式。
2.4 通过命令行工具查看
在Windows系统中,可以通过命令行工具查看Excel文件的编码方式。
1. 打开命令提示符(CMD)。
2. 输入以下命令:
chcp 65001
这个命令会切换到UTF-8编码方式,显示的字符会以Unicode形式显示。
3. 退出命令提示符,即可看到当前编码方式。
三、Excel编码方式的优缺点分析
不同编码方式在存储和处理数据时各有优劣,了解其优缺点有助于我们在实际工作中做出合理选择。
3.1 UTF-8的优势
- 国际通用:支持多种语言字符,是现代办公中最常用的方式。
- 兼容性好:在Web开发、数据交换中广泛应用。
- 可扩展性强:支持Unicode字符,适用于多语言环境。
3.2 UTF-16的优势
- 支持Unicode:能够存储和处理各种语言字符。
- 适用于Windows系统:是Windows系统中默认的编码方式。
- 可扩展性强:支持多种语言和编码方式。
3.3 ASCII的优势
- 简单易用:仅支持英文字符,适合基础数据处理。
- 兼容性强:在早期Excel版本中广泛使用。
3.4 缺点分析
- ASCII编码:仅支持英文字符,无法处理其他语言字符。
- ISO-8859-1编码:仅支持拉丁字母,不能处理其他语言字符。
- GB2312编码:仅支持中文字符,无法处理其他语言字符。
四、如何在Excel中进行编码转换
在实际工作中,有时需要将Excel文件从一种编码方式转换为另一种编码方式。以下是几种常见的转换方法。
4.1 使用Excel内置功能
- 转换编码方式:在Excel中,可以通过“文件”菜单中的“信息”选项,选择“转换编码方式”。
- 选择目标编码:在“转换编码方式”窗口中,选择目标编码方式,即可完成转换。
4.2 使用VBA脚本进行编码转换
vba
Sub ConvertEncoding()
Dim sourceEncoding As String
Dim targetEncoding As String
sourceEncoding = ActiveWorkbook.Encoding
targetEncoding = "UTF-8"
ActiveWorkbook.Encoding = targetEncoding
MsgBox "编码已转换为: " & targetEncoding
End Sub
运行这段代码后,Excel会将当前文件的编码方式转换为指定的编码方式。
4.3 使用第三方工具进行编码转换
有许多第三方工具可以帮助用户进行Excel编码转换,例如:
- Excel编码转换器:提供多种编码方式的转换功能。
- Unicode转换工具:支持多种编码方式的转换。
五、编码方式对数据处理的影响
编码方式的选择直接影响数据的存储、读取和计算结果的准确性。因此,了解当前使用的编码方式并合理选择编码方式,是数据处理过程中不可忽视的重要环节。
5.1 编码方式对数据存储的影响
- UTF-8:存储效率高,适合大规模数据存储。
- UTF-16:存储效率较低,但支持Unicode字符。
- ASCII:存储效率低,仅支持英文字符。
5.2 编码方式对数据读取的影响
- UTF-8:读取效率高,适合多语言数据。
- UTF-16:读取效率较低,但支持Unicode字符。
- ASCII:读取效率低,仅支持英文字符。
5.3 编码方式对数据计算的影响
- UTF-8:计算效率高,适合多语言数据。
- UTF-16:计算效率较低,但支持Unicode字符。
- ASCII:计算效率低,仅支持英文字符。
六、总结与建议
在Excel中,了解当前使用的编码方式对数据处理至关重要。通过文件属性、Excel设置、VBA脚本和命令行工具等多种方式,可以判断当前Excel使用的是哪种编码方式。在实际工作中,根据数据内容选择合适的编码方式,能够提高数据处理的效率和准确性。
建议在处理多语言数据时,使用UTF-8编码方式;在处理单一语言数据时,使用ASCII或ISO-8859-1编码方式。同时,对于需要频繁转换编码的用户,建议使用VBA脚本或第三方工具进行编码转换。
七、深度思考:编码方式的未来发展趋势
随着全球化和数字技术的发展,编码方式也在不断演进。未来,Unicode将成为主流编码方式,支持更加丰富的字符集,提升数据处理的灵活性和兼容性。
对于Excel用户来说,掌握编码方式的判断和转换方法,将有助于提升数据处理的效率和准确性,适应不断变化的数字办公环境。
八、实用技巧与注意事项
在实际操作中,需要注意以下几点:
- 文件编码一致性:在处理多文件时,确保所有文件使用相同的编码方式,避免数据混乱。
- 编码转换的稳定性:在转换编码方式时,仔细检查数据,确保转换后的数据准确无误。
- 编码方式的选择:根据数据内容选择合适的编码方式,避免因编码错误导致数据丢失或错误。
九、
Excel的编码方式直接影响数据的存储、读取和计算结果。了解当前使用的编码方式,并合理选择和转换编码方式,是数据处理过程中不可忽视的重要环节。通过本文的深入解析,希望读者能够掌握如何判断和操作Excel的编码方式,提升数据处理的效率和准确性。
在使用Excel处理数据时,了解当前使用的编码方式至关重要。Excel的编码方式直接影响数据的存储、读取以及计算结果的准确性。本文将从Excel编码的基本概念出发,逐步分析其工作原理,并提供实用的判断与操作方法,帮助用户全面掌握如何判断当前Excel使用的是哪种编码。
一、Excel编码的基本概念
Excel文件本质上是基于二进制格式存储的,但为了便于人类阅读和操作,Excel使用了一种称为字符编码的机制,将字符转换为数字,以实现数据的存储与处理。Excel支持多种编码方式,其中最常见的包括UTF-8、UTF-16、ASCII、ISO-8859-1等。
1.1 编码的作用
编码的作用在于将字符转换为统一的数字形式,使得不同系统之间能够一致地理解和处理数据。例如,ASCII编码是最早的编码方式,只支持英文字符,而UTF-8则支持多种语言的字符,包括中文、日文、韩文等。
1.2 Excel支持的编码方式
Excel支持以下几种主要编码方式:
- UTF-8:国际通用的编码方式,支持多种语言字符,是现代办公中最常用的方式。
- UTF-16:比UTF-8更复杂,适用于Unicode字符的存储,是Windows系统中默认的编码方式。
- ASCII:仅支持英文字符,是最早的编码方式。
- ISO-8859-1:是欧洲地区常用的编码方式,支持拉丁字母。
- KOI8-R:俄罗斯地区常用的编码方式。
- GB2312:中国地区常用的编码方式。
- Big5:台湾地区常用的编码方式。
二、如何判断当前Excel使用的是哪种编码
判断当前Excel使用的是哪种编码,可以通过以下几种方式实现。
2.1 通过文件属性查看
Excel文件在Windows系统中,可以通过右键点击文件,选择“属性”来查看文件的编码方式。
1. 右键点击Excel文件。
2. 选择“属性”。
3. 点击“详细信息”标签。
4. 在“文件属性”中,查看“编码”字段,即可知道当前文件所使用的编码方式。
2.2 通过Excel的设置查看
在Excel中,可以通过设置查看当前使用的编码方式。
1. 打开Excel,点击左上角的“文件”菜单。
2. 选择“选项”。
3. 在“Excel选项”窗口中,点击“高级”。
4. 在“字体”选项卡中,查看“编码”字段,即可知道当前使用的编码方式。
2.3 通过VBA脚本查看
对于高级用户,可以通过VBA脚本来查看Excel当前使用的编码方式。
vba
Sub ShowEncoding()
Dim encoding As String
encoding = ActiveWorkbook.Encoding
MsgBox "当前Excel编码为: " & encoding
End Sub
运行这段代码后,Excel会弹出一个消息框,显示当前使用的编码方式。
2.4 通过命令行工具查看
在Windows系统中,可以通过命令行工具查看Excel文件的编码方式。
1. 打开命令提示符(CMD)。
2. 输入以下命令:
chcp 65001
这个命令会切换到UTF-8编码方式,显示的字符会以Unicode形式显示。
3. 退出命令提示符,即可看到当前编码方式。
三、Excel编码方式的优缺点分析
不同编码方式在存储和处理数据时各有优劣,了解其优缺点有助于我们在实际工作中做出合理选择。
3.1 UTF-8的优势
- 国际通用:支持多种语言字符,是现代办公中最常用的方式。
- 兼容性好:在Web开发、数据交换中广泛应用。
- 可扩展性强:支持Unicode字符,适用于多语言环境。
3.2 UTF-16的优势
- 支持Unicode:能够存储和处理各种语言字符。
- 适用于Windows系统:是Windows系统中默认的编码方式。
- 可扩展性强:支持多种语言和编码方式。
3.3 ASCII的优势
- 简单易用:仅支持英文字符,适合基础数据处理。
- 兼容性强:在早期Excel版本中广泛使用。
3.4 缺点分析
- ASCII编码:仅支持英文字符,无法处理其他语言字符。
- ISO-8859-1编码:仅支持拉丁字母,不能处理其他语言字符。
- GB2312编码:仅支持中文字符,无法处理其他语言字符。
四、如何在Excel中进行编码转换
在实际工作中,有时需要将Excel文件从一种编码方式转换为另一种编码方式。以下是几种常见的转换方法。
4.1 使用Excel内置功能
- 转换编码方式:在Excel中,可以通过“文件”菜单中的“信息”选项,选择“转换编码方式”。
- 选择目标编码:在“转换编码方式”窗口中,选择目标编码方式,即可完成转换。
4.2 使用VBA脚本进行编码转换
vba
Sub ConvertEncoding()
Dim sourceEncoding As String
Dim targetEncoding As String
sourceEncoding = ActiveWorkbook.Encoding
targetEncoding = "UTF-8"
ActiveWorkbook.Encoding = targetEncoding
MsgBox "编码已转换为: " & targetEncoding
End Sub
运行这段代码后,Excel会将当前文件的编码方式转换为指定的编码方式。
4.3 使用第三方工具进行编码转换
有许多第三方工具可以帮助用户进行Excel编码转换,例如:
- Excel编码转换器:提供多种编码方式的转换功能。
- Unicode转换工具:支持多种编码方式的转换。
五、编码方式对数据处理的影响
编码方式的选择直接影响数据的存储、读取和计算结果的准确性。因此,了解当前使用的编码方式并合理选择编码方式,是数据处理过程中不可忽视的重要环节。
5.1 编码方式对数据存储的影响
- UTF-8:存储效率高,适合大规模数据存储。
- UTF-16:存储效率较低,但支持Unicode字符。
- ASCII:存储效率低,仅支持英文字符。
5.2 编码方式对数据读取的影响
- UTF-8:读取效率高,适合多语言数据。
- UTF-16:读取效率较低,但支持Unicode字符。
- ASCII:读取效率低,仅支持英文字符。
5.3 编码方式对数据计算的影响
- UTF-8:计算效率高,适合多语言数据。
- UTF-16:计算效率较低,但支持Unicode字符。
- ASCII:计算效率低,仅支持英文字符。
六、总结与建议
在Excel中,了解当前使用的编码方式对数据处理至关重要。通过文件属性、Excel设置、VBA脚本和命令行工具等多种方式,可以判断当前Excel使用的是哪种编码方式。在实际工作中,根据数据内容选择合适的编码方式,能够提高数据处理的效率和准确性。
建议在处理多语言数据时,使用UTF-8编码方式;在处理单一语言数据时,使用ASCII或ISO-8859-1编码方式。同时,对于需要频繁转换编码的用户,建议使用VBA脚本或第三方工具进行编码转换。
七、深度思考:编码方式的未来发展趋势
随着全球化和数字技术的发展,编码方式也在不断演进。未来,Unicode将成为主流编码方式,支持更加丰富的字符集,提升数据处理的灵活性和兼容性。
对于Excel用户来说,掌握编码方式的判断和转换方法,将有助于提升数据处理的效率和准确性,适应不断变化的数字办公环境。
八、实用技巧与注意事项
在实际操作中,需要注意以下几点:
- 文件编码一致性:在处理多文件时,确保所有文件使用相同的编码方式,避免数据混乱。
- 编码转换的稳定性:在转换编码方式时,仔细检查数据,确保转换后的数据准确无误。
- 编码方式的选择:根据数据内容选择合适的编码方式,避免因编码错误导致数据丢失或错误。
九、
Excel的编码方式直接影响数据的存储、读取和计算结果。了解当前使用的编码方式,并合理选择和转换编码方式,是数据处理过程中不可忽视的重要环节。通过本文的深入解析,希望读者能够掌握如何判断和操作Excel的编码方式,提升数据处理的效率和准确性。
推荐文章
Excel 默认边框线颜色的深度解析在Excel这个广泛使用的电子表格软件中,边框线是一种基本的可视化工具,用于区分单元格之间的内容、强调重要信息,或者在数据展示中提升可读性。而“默认边框线什么颜色”这一问题,正是用户在使用Excel
2026-01-22 22:57:05
207人看过
Excel 中“长度”是什么意思?Excel 是一款广泛应用于数据处理和分析的电子表格软件,它提供了丰富的功能来帮助用户高效地管理、分析和可视化数据。在 Excel 中,“长度”是一个常见的术语,尤其是在涉及字符串、字符、单元格内容或
2026-01-22 22:56:38
278人看过
为什么Excel表格打字特别慢?深度解析与实用建议在日常工作中,Excel表格几乎是不可或缺的工具。无论是数据统计、财务分析,还是项目管理,Excel都能发挥重要作用。然而,随着数据量的增加,很多人发现Excel在输入数据时速度变慢,
2026-01-22 22:56:34
398人看过
Excel 工具栏分别代表什么?深度解析与实用指南Excel 是一个功能强大的电子表格软件,广泛应用于数据分析、财务建模、项目管理等领域。在 Excel 中,工具栏是用户进行操作的核心界面,它包含了各种实用功能按钮和选项,能够帮助用户
2026-01-22 22:56:01
334人看过
.webp)

.webp)
